Delirium Christmas / Delirium Noël – Brouwerij Huyghe, 10% ABV, 330ml., (Melle, Belgium)
- Style: Belgian Strong Ale
- Taste: Start-to-finish clean toffee barley malt grape/berry subtle hops

Visual: Pours opaque brownish red with a massive lasting ultra creamy head, 2mm retention, a bit of lacing, fast singular streams.
Nose: yeasty honey, apple, banana wheaty candi barley malt (lvl-6)-pungency
Attack: crisp, micro tingly-creamy
Mid-palate: (lvl-7)-sweetness, micro-fizzy, (MAIN) toffee barley malt, caramel, grape/berry
Finish: alcohol zingy, soft bitter hops, alcohol detection, malty residual bubbly clean finish.
Summary: Supremely drinkable with expertly hidden 10% ABV; it’s incredible how smooth they made it. Great beer from start to finish.
(12/26/2016 re-tasting): Not as smooth as I remember; Quite alcohol forward and slightly too sour aggressive. Smoothness is noteworthy but the flavour isn’t particularly memorable. Score downgraded from [A to B]
